Review of The Captain (2018) by Stefano C — 01 Oct 2018
What an horrific and crazy journey this is. Amazingly shot in black and white, that never felt as right as it is in here, the film tells the story of a simple soldier pretending to be a captain in the last weeks of WW2.
The absurdity of the actions of the men involved, is matched only by the absurdity of that period, but everything is told not with sheer sadness, but with a caustic look that will make you shiver nonetheless.
One of those stories that are so crazy that can only be true...
